Aurora C1 is a member of the aurora/Ipl1p family of protein kinases that are important regulators of mitosis.2 Aurora C is a novel chromosomal passenger protein that, in coordination with Aurora B, regulates mitotic chromosome dynamics in human cells.3,4 Aurora C may play a role in organizing microtubules relating to the function of the centrosome/spindle pole during mitosis, and is localized to the centrosome from anaphase to cytokinesis.5 The expression of Aurora C is maximum at M phase.5 Aurora C is activated by directly associating with inner centromere protein (INCENP).3 Aurora C is expressed in normal testis6, and elevated expression levels are seen in a subset of cancer cells such as HepG2 and HeLa cells.5
